1.G32 rotary joint is a precision dynamic sealing device used to connect rotating and fixed components, achieving continuous transmission of fluid media. Its nominal diameter is 32mm (interface thread R1-1/4 “), which is a commonly used specification in G series spherical sealed rotary joints.
The joint mainly adopts a spherical sealing structure, and the outer tube body is directly connected to the roller or dryer as the main rotating component. The precision machined outer tube spherical surface and impregnated graphite spherical sealing ring together form a reliable dynamic sealing friction pair. The spherical sealing ring slides in the annular space inside the shell, and the tight fit between the oil-free bearing and the shell allows the rotating joint to be freely supported, with low requirements for installation accuracy.
When the medium (steam, water, thermal oil, etc.) flows through the spherical sealing ring and oil-free bearing, a very thin liquid film will be formed, which has both sealing and lubrication functions, effectively reducing friction and wear, and extending the service life. The shell adopts a double ear support structure, which makes the large-scale rotating joint support more stable and the sealing more stable.
2.The “G” in G32 represents the spherical seal series, and “32” represents the nominal diameter of 32mm. Common complete models include QS-G32 (bi-directional flow, inner pipe fixation, threaded connection), JFS-G32-15 (mechanical seal type), QRS-G32 (bi-directional flow, inner pipe fixation, threaded connection, improved type), HS-G32 (brass material, quick connector type), etc. The naming rules may vary slightly among different manufacturers
3.Scope of application
G32 rotary joints are widely used in various industrial scenarios that require the transfer of fluid media from fixed pipelines to rotating equipment. Its applicable media include saturated steam, superheated steam, hot water, thermal oil, cooling water, air, etc., covering many industrial fields.

This “T series” is actually a T-port rotary joint, designed to facilitate multi-directional fluid flow under rotating conditions.
Features:
Suitable for use with air, water, hydraulic oil, low-temperature heat transfer oil, and other media.
Supports bidirectional flow, enabling flexible on-off combinations among three ports.
Compact structure, reliable sealing, suitable for medium and low speed conditions.
Model example: DN65-DN200, etc. rotary joint

Typical structure:
Shell: Made of brass or stainless steel, resistant to corrosion.
Sealing system: It adopts a flat seal, coupled with a multi-spring compensation mechanism. The rotating and stationary seals are removable and replaceable, facilitating easy maintenance and ensuring sealing performance under both high and low pressures.
Rotating stop device: Install a rotating stop rod through the support hole to prevent the housing from rotating with the shaft
